Microsoft MVPs inside





 MCSEboard.de – IT Pro Forum zu Windows Server 2008 R2 / 2008 / 2003 & Windows 7 / Vista / XP
Registrieren Hilfe Regeln Benutzerliste Suchen Heutige Beiträge Alle Foren als gelesen markieren

MS SQL Server Forum


Alles zum Thema Microsoft SQL Server — Q & A zu Microsoft SQL Server 2000 / 2005 / 2008 Architektur, Konfiguration, Troubleshooting


Antwort
     
Themen-Optionen
Alt 09.05.2005, 19:04   #1
Senior Member
 
Benutzerbild von Tom-Cat
 
Offline
Registriert seit: 01-2005
Ort: Rheda-Wiedenbrück (Gütersloh)
Beiträge: 319
SQL Server Script einfügen

Hallo zusammen,

ich habe einen SQL Server.
Nun hab ich eine Script Datei bla.sql
diese Datei beinhaltet eine Komplette Datenbank die ich ja nun in mein SQL reinhaben möchte.
Wie kann ich diese Datei importieren ?

LG Thomas

Signatur
Acronis Certified Partner

    Mit Zitat antworten
Alt 09.05.2005, 19:10   #2
Board Veteran
 
Benutzerbild von BuzzeR
 
Offline
Registriert seit: 02-2005
Ort: Iserlohn
Beiträge: 1.004
Nun, ...

... nichts einfacher als das. Nimm entweder den Query Analyzer, connecte Dich
mit der DB, lade Dein Script und führe es durch drücken auf den Play-Button aus,
oder nimm osql. Letzteres würde ich präferieren ...

osql -S Servername -U Benutzername -P Passwort -i bla.sql

That's it ... Gruß
Marco
    Mit Zitat antworten
Alt 09.05.2005, 19:13   #3
Senior Member
 
Benutzerbild von Tom-Cat
 
Offline
Registriert seit: 01-2005
Ort: Rheda-Wiedenbrück (Gütersloh)
Beiträge: 319
hey supiii dankkeee ;-)

das ist doch mal einfach

LG THomas

Signatur
Acronis Certified Partner

    Mit Zitat antworten
Alt 09.05.2005, 19:16   #4
Board Veteran
 
Benutzerbild von BuzzeR
 
Offline
Registriert seit: 02-2005
Ort: Iserlohn
Beiträge: 1.004
War mir und allen hifreichen Seelen ...

... hier on Board ein Vergnügen. Hoffe geholfen zu haben und noch viel
Spaß auf MCSEboard.de!!

Gruß
Marco
    Mit Zitat antworten
Alt 09.05.2005, 19:46   #5
Senior Member
 
Benutzerbild von Tom-Cat
 
Offline
Registriert seit: 01-2005
Ort: Rheda-Wiedenbrück (Gütersloh)
Beiträge: 319
hmm jetzt hab ich doch ein problem.

ich habe das mal in diesen Analyser gestartet ! das dauert ja ewig ! bez. man sieht gar keine Fortschritt oder so !
ich muss doch vorher die Datenbank anlegen ?!!?!!

und das mit dem Befehl geht nicht irgendwie Benutzernamen fehler obwohl ich meinen Admin und das PAsswort nehme..

komisch ... komisch !

Signatur
Acronis Certified Partner

    Mit Zitat antworten
Alt 09.05.2005, 19:58   #6
Board Veteran
 
Benutzerbild von BuzzeR
 
Offline
Registriert seit: 02-2005
Ort: Iserlohn
Beiträge: 1.004
Okee, dann halt Hardcore! ;o)

Du hast es so gewollt!

Hast Du mit Deinem Skript vor eine DB anzulegen? Ich nehme mal an, das nicht.

Wenn Du ein Skript hast, welches eine DB anlegt, so sollte in den ersten Zeilen des
Skriptes das folgende stehen:

Code:
USE master
GO

IF EXISTS( SELECT name FROM sysdatabases WHERE name='MeineDatenbank' )
  BEGIN
    DROP DATABASE MeineDatenbank
  END
  GO
Diese Befehle sorgen im Rahmen des Testprozesses, dass eine vorhandene DB
mit gleichem Namen gelöscht wird.

Was die Authentifizierung angeht, so nimm mal den Query Analyzer und starte ihn,
connecte Dich mit dem sa - Account und dem dazugehörigen Passwort.

Lade Dein Skript und führe es wie beschrieben aus. Sollte das noch immer nicht
funktionieren, so kannst Du mir auch das Skript vial Mail zukommen lassen und
ich werde es für Deine Erfordernisse anpassen.

LG
Marco
    Mit Zitat antworten
Alt 09.05.2005, 20:13   #7
Senior Member
 
Benutzerbild von Tom-Cat
 
Offline
Registriert seit: 01-2005
Ort: Rheda-Wiedenbrück (Gütersloh)
Beiträge: 319
Also:
wenn ich den Analysa da starte dann muss ich doch ne Datenbank auswählen wo das teil reinsoll oder wie sollich das verstehen ?

ich klicke auf öffnen nehme meine bal.sql datei und dann muss ich doch rechts neben dem START button die DB wählen oder nicht ?

ja so ist das Script von mir aufgebaut !
und danach fügt er die Struktur ein!

LG THomas

Signatur
Acronis Certified Partner

    Mit Zitat antworten
Alt 09.05.2005, 20:14   #8
Senior Member
 
Benutzerbild von Tom-Cat
 
Offline
Registriert seit: 01-2005
Ort: Rheda-Wiedenbrück (Gütersloh)
Beiträge: 319
du kommst aus Iserlohn ?????
darf ich mal fragen wie du mit vornamen heist ??

------------------
Ziehe ich zurück ich sehe den namen ja :-)

Geändert von Tom-Cat (09.05.2005 um 20:15 Uhr). Grund: Falsch

Signatur
Acronis Certified Partner

    Mit Zitat antworten
Alt 09.05.2005, 20:22   #9
Board Veteran
 
Benutzerbild von BuzzeR
 
Offline
Registriert seit: 02-2005
Ort: Iserlohn
Beiträge: 1.004
Da isser wieder, ich habe ...

... es befürchtet! Nun gut. Machen wir es mal Step-by-Step.

Connecte Dich mit dem sa - Account auf dem DB-Server via Query Analyzer.

Lade mittels Datei -> Öffnen das besagte Skript.

Mittig de Toolbars steht ein Drop-Down-Field mit der gerade aktiven Datenbank.
Hier sollte master stehen. Klicke auf das Drop-Down-Field und suche die
DB aus, auf welcher Dein Skript ausgeführt werden soll.

Hast Du das gemacht, dann starte die Ausführung mittels Druck auf den Play-Button.

Hat das geklappt?

LG
Marco
    Mit Zitat antworten
Alt 09.05.2005, 20:25   #10
Senior Member
 
Benutzerbild von Tom-Cat
 
Offline
Registriert seit: 01-2005
Ort: Rheda-Wiedenbrück (Gütersloh)
Beiträge: 319
hm okes alles klar !
hab ich soi gemacht !
dann kommt aber nix ! bez. er zeigt mir nix an und auch wenn ich in die Datenbank über den Enterprise Manager reingehe sehe ich keine einträge ! :-(

Signatur
Acronis Certified Partner

    Mit Zitat antworten
Antwort


Themen-Optionen


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
2K3 Server in SBS Domäne einfügen, aber nicht im lokalen Netz Bromer Windows Server Forum 5 07.01.2006 15:39
mssql server 2000 - punkt und strich einfügen Corraggiouno MS SQL Server Forum 2 30.05.2005 14:42
Windows 2003 Server in eine Windows 2000 Domäne einfügen floroegner Windows Forum — Allgemein 3 18.03.2005 10:58
2K - Host datei richtig in den dns server einfügen TriplexXx Windows Forum — LAN & WAN 1 06.04.2004 12:20
Einfügen hammer747 Windows Forum — Allgemein 3 26.09.2003 09:01


Alle Zeitangaben in MEZ/CET. Es ist jetzt 22:59 Uhr. Seite generiert in 0,051 Sekunden.

- Unsere Partner -

Copyright © 2000 – 2012 MCSEboard.de

Sprung zum Seitenanfang